Health Advocates offered at Salishan Community Health Advocates
Provide activities and events that promote healthy food, gardening, active living and building community within the Salishan neighborhood. Teaches people things they can do to keep their family healthy in ways that make sense culturally. Helps people understand how to prevent or manage chronic diseases such as diabetes and high blood pressure. Helps neighbors understand instructions from their doctors and on their prescriptions. Connects residents with resources and assists with applying for services. Advocates are people who live in the Salishan community and who are trained in various topics related to chronic disease prevention and management. They use their talents, knowledge and skills to improve their own health and to model new healthy behaviors for their friends and families. Advocates come from many languages and cultures including: Spanish, Cambodian, Lao, Vietnamese, Thai, Russian and more.
